Actual comment posted after the article:

It’s not quite as bleak a picture as you paint here in the Empire State. We are “may issue” and thus if a gun owner dies and no one has a permit, the police may take such weapons.

There are 2 solutions. First, delay the obituary, the police read them, too. Second,have an estate plan and register your guns on someone else’s permit.

For example, I have my brother’s guns on mine and he has mine on his. Our wills reflect this, problem solved.

If you plan poorly be it in you possessions or finances, the state makes the decisions. The New York State police are not the gestapo, they are following the law.
